Evaluation of interventions led by pharmacists in antimicrobial stewardship programs in low- and middle-income countries: a systematic literature review
Abstract Objective: We performed a systematic literature review to identify and describe pharmacist-led antimicrobial stewardship programs (ASPs) interventions in low- and middle-income countries (LMICs).
